TLZ3V9-GS08 Product Overview

Introduction

The TLZ3V9-GS08 is a versatile electronic component that belongs to the category of voltage regulator diodes. This product is commonly used in various electronic circuits to regulate voltage and protect sensitive components from overvoltage conditions. Working Principles

The TLZ3V9-GS08 operates based on the principle of Zener diode voltage regulation. When the voltage across the diode reaches the specified 3.9V, it begins conducting, effectively regulating the output voltage.
